Les Farges Mine pyromorphites are world renowned for their quality and beauty. This showy and excellent CABINET combination specimen features a rich scattering of clusters of glassy, actually gemmy, translucent, pretty apple-green pyromorphite prisms to 8 mm with oxide-coated, barite blades on a sculptural, triangular, quartz matrix crust. Several of the pyros are doubly terminated. Yes, there is some bruising, mainly to the barite blades, and some periphery wear is noted. Still, this remains an uncommonly large combination example of these species from a famous locale; and the pyromorphites are exceptionally gemmy for Les Farges. The December, 2009 issue of the French periodical, le Regne Mineral, is devoted entirely to this noted locale and is filled with photgraphs of fabulous Les Farges pyromorphites.
